Contact dermatitis in children.
TL;DR: 168 children, 14 years of age or younger, were patch tested with the Standard Series of the International Contact Dermatitis Research Group (ICDRG) over a 5-year period, 77 of the children had 1 or more positive reactions: relevant test results were found in 80% of them.

Contact dermatitis and adverse oral mucous membrane reactions related to the use of dental prostheses.
TL;DR: The latest trends in the use and composition of dental prostheses have been reviewed, and 66 patients referred by dermatologists and odontologists patch tested, and nickel, cobalt, potassium dichromate, rhodium, palladium, mercury, beryllium, methyl methacrytale, copper and zinc found to be positive.

Occupational dermatoses from cutting oils
TL;DR: 230 patients with occupational dermatitis in I ho metallurgic industry were studied with standard patch tests (GEIDC) and an oil series and responses to paraphenylenediamine, chrome, cobalt, and benzisothiazolone, triethanolamine, and Grotan BK® were the main positive results.

Statistical and comparative study of 4600 patients tested in Barcelona (1973-1977).
Carlos Romaguera,F. Grimalt +1 more
TL;DR: The authors show the results obtained during the 5‐year period 1973–1977 in 4600 patch tested patients in the Allergy Department of Barcelona University, showing 5.02 % of the tested patients showed sensitization to benzidine.
